要绑定虚拟主机到Cloudflare的CDN,需先在Cloudflare添加网站,然后修改DNS记录将域名指向Cloudflare提供的NS服务器,最后在Cloudflare控制面板配置SSL和缓存设置。
在互联网技术不断发展的今天,内容分发网络(CDN)已经成为提高网站访问速度和稳定性的重要手段,通过将网站的静态资源分布到全球各地的服务器上,CDN可以让用户更快地访问到所需的内容,而虚拟主机则是托管网站的一种常见方式,将CDN与虚拟主机结合使用,可以让网站的性能更上一层楼,下面将详细介绍如何将CDN绑定到虚拟主机上。
准备工作
在开始之前,你需要准备以下几项:
1、一个已经购买并设置好的虚拟主机账户。
2、一个CDN服务提供商的账户,如Cloudflare、Akamai等。
3、你的域名DNS管理权限,通常通过域名注册商提供。
步骤一:配置虚拟主机
登录你的虚拟主机控制面板,一般会有文件管理器、数据库管理、邮件服务等选项,确保你的网站文件已经上传到指定目录,数据库也已经创建并正确配置。
步骤二:设置CDN服务
登录你的CDN服务提供商账户,添加新站点或域名,并按照提供商的指引完成初步设置,这通常包括选择服务计划、设置缓存规则等。
步骤三:修改DNS记录
要将CDN绑定到虚拟主机,关键在于修改你的域名的DNS记录,你需要将域名的CNAME记录指向CDN服务提供商为你生成的域名,这通常在CDN服务提供商的控制面板中有明确指示。
1、登录你的域名注册商的DNS管理界面。
2、找到你的域名对应的CNAME记录。
3、将CNAME记录的值改为CDN服务商提供的域名。
4、保存更改,等待DNS生效,这可能需要几分钟到几小时不等。
步骤四:测试和优化
DNS记录生效后,你可以通过访问你的域名来测试CDN是否正常工作,你可以根据CDN服务提供商的建议进一步优化缓存策略,以提高网站性能。
相关问题与解答
Q1: CDN绑定后网站无法访问怎么办?
A1: 确认DNS记录是否已经更新并生效,如果DNS没有问题,检查虚拟主机和CDN的配置是否正确,如果问题依旧存在,请联系CDN服务提供商或虚拟主机支持团队寻求帮助。
Q2: CDN会影响搜索引擎优化(SEO)吗?
A2: 如果正确配置,CDN对SEO是有益的,因为它提高了网站的加载速度和可用性,这两者都是搜索引擎排名的重要因素,确保CDN服务提供商的缓存设置不会阻止搜索引擎爬虫访问网站的真实内容。
Q3: 是否所有类型的网站都适合使用CDN?
A3: 大多数以内容为主的网站都会从CDN中受益,特别是那些面向全球用户的网站,对于一些高度动态或需要频繁更新的网站,CDN可能不是最佳选择,或者需要特别配置以确保内容的实时更新。
Q4: 是否可以在同一网站上同时使用多个CDN服务?
A4: 理论上是可以的,但实际操作可能会非常复杂,因为不同的CDN服务商可能有不同的配置要求和缓存机制,通常,使用单一CDN服务已经足够满足大多数网站的需求,如果确实需要,建议咨询专业人士进行配置。